After that we didnt make it with our own damn car,we booked a tour up to the volcano el tatio.
We got up at 4.00AM!!! 2 1/2 hour horror drive on bumpy paths till the top. -10C when we got up there without any real mountain clothing was quite a bit cold. But after sunrise it got warmer and the amazing view of all geysiers made it all worth it. On the way back, we saw some kind of strange animals. Vicuñas, they live on 4000alt and the bigger brother Lamas live on 3000alt. We passed a native village with the funny population of only 7 people. After this journey we were ready for some beers and we had a very funny evening with some british engineers,who are taking care of some Star Observatories. Now, we saw the highest geysiers of the world and have been in the driest area of the world ,so whats next..............
